Supreme Court of India · 1970-08-12

UNION OF INDIA vs COL. J. N. SINHA AND ANR.

Judgment text excerpt

The Supreme Court held that the principles of natural justice do not apply when a statutory provision, such as Rule 56(j) of the Fundamental Rules, explicitly allows for compulsory retirement without the necessity of providing an opportunity to show cause. The Court clarified that these principles can only operate in areas not covered by valid law, and since Rule 56(j) does not mandate a hearing, the High Court's ruling was overturned. The Court emphasized that the authority's opinion on public interest in such matters is absolute and cannot be challenged if formed bona fide.
